PVA1352N Technical Specifications

Parameter Value
Relay Type Solid-State Relay
Isolation Voltage 3750 Vrms (input to output)
Output Configuration Normally Open (1-Form-A)
Maximum Load Voltage 350 V
Maximum Load Current 120 mA
Input Control Voltage 1.2 V (typical LED forward voltage)
On-State Resistance 30 ?? (typical)
Package 8-DIP (Dual Inline Package)
Operating Temperature Range -40??C to +85??C

FAQ

What is the primary isolation advantage of the PVA1352N?

This solid-state relay provides optical isolation rated at 3750 Vrms between input and output, ensuring that control circuits remain protected from high voltages and electrical noise in load circuits.

Can the relay handle both AC and DC loads?

The device is generally suitable for switching both AC and DC loads up to its maximum voltage and current ratings. However, application specifics should be reviewed to ensure safe operation within limits.

What is the typical input drive requirement for this relay?

The relay is actuated via a low forward voltage LED input (approximately 1.2 V), making it compatible with standard logic level outputs and simplifying system design by reducing the need for complex drivers.

How does the PVA1352N improve operational lifespan compared to mechanical relays?

Its solid-state design eliminates mechanical contacts, resulting in silent operation and substantially longer operational life, as there is no physical wear or contact degradation over time.

In which temperature environments can this relay operate reliably?

Engineered to withstand a wide temperature range, the relay operates reliably from -40??C to +85??C, making it suitable for most industrial and commercial environments.
